The Lifecycle of a Medical Implant Device
The journey of a medical implant device is a complex and multifaceted process that encompasses multiple stages, from initial design to eventual insertion. The initial stage involves rigorous exploration and development of the device concept, driven by a deep understanding of clinical needs and patient outcomes.
Subsequent stages include meticulous design to ensure both efficacy and biocompatibility. Thorough testing protocols, encompassing both in vitro and in vivo simulations, are crucial to validate the device's functionality.
